Artificial Intelligence (AI) has revolutionized the way businesses approach marketing. With the help of AI tools, marketers can now analyze vast amounts of data, predict customer behavior, and personalize their campaigns to a level never seen before. These tools have significantly enhanced marketing strategies, leading to improved customer targeting, increased conversion rates, and better overall business performance.

One of the primary functions of AI tools in marketing is data analysis. Traditional methods of analyzing data are time-consuming and often produce incomplete or inaccurate results. However, AI algorithms can swiftly analyze massive datasets, extracting valuable insights and patterns. Marketers can then use these insights to make informed decisions about their campaigns, resulting in more targeted and effective marketing efforts.

Another essential application of AI tools in marketing is predictive analytics. By leveraging machine learning algorithms, marketers can forecast customer behavior, such as purchase patterns or response to specific campaigns. This enables them to proactively tailor their marketing strategies to meet customer demands and expectations, ultimately leading to higher conversion rates and customer satisfaction.

AI tools also offer the capability to personalize marketing campaigns to individual customers’ preferences and needs. Through the analysis of various data points, such as purchase history, online behavior, and demographic information, AI algorithms can dynamically generate personalized content, product recommendations, and offers for each customer. This level of personalization improves customer engagement and increases the likelihood of conversions.

AI tools have also made marketing automation more efficient. By automating repetitive tasks such as email marketing, lead nurturing, and social media management, marketers can focus on more strategic activities. This not only saves time and resources but also enables businesses to maintain consistent and personalized communication with customers at scale.

As AI tools become more advanced, marketers can leverage them to optimize their marketing campaigns further. For example, AI algorithms can analyze historical data to identify churn risks and provide recommendations on how to prevent customer attrition. They can also determine the best time and channel to deliver marketing messages, thereby enhancing overall campaign performance and driving higher customer engagement.

Artificial intelligence (AI) tools have greatly transformed the marketing landscape, enabling marketers to enhance customer experiences, optimize campaigns, and drive business growth. This article explores ten key AI tools utilized in marketing and showcases their significant impact.

1. Personalization Engines

Personalization engines leverage AI algorithms to deliver tailored content and experiences to individual users. By analyzing customer data, preferences, and behaviors, these tools allow marketers to create highly targeted marketing campaigns that resonate with their audience, boosting engagement and conversion rates.

2. Chatbots and Virtual Assistants

Chatbots and virtual assistants are AI-powered tools that provide automated customer support and interactions. They simulate human-like conversations, answering customer queries, assisting with purchases, and delivering personalized recommendations. These tools improve customer satisfaction, reduce response times, and increase overall efficiency.

3. Predictive Analytics

Predictive analytics leverages AI algorithms to forecast future outcomes based on historical data. Marketers utilize these tools to identify trends, anticipate customer behavior, and optimize marketing strategies in real-time. By accurately predicting customer preferences and actions, businesses can make data-driven decisions that drive revenue and business growth.

4. Natural Language Processing

Natural Language Processing (NLP) enables AI tools to understand and interpret human language in a way that is similar to how humans do. Marketers use NLP-powered sentiment analysis tools to gain insights into customer opinions, attitudes, and emotions expressed through text or speech. This information helps marketers craft more persuasive and targeted marketing messages.

5. Marketing Automation

Marketing automation tools streamline repetitive marketing tasks by leveraging AI capabilities. These tools enable marketers to automate email campaigns, social media postings, lead nurturing, and data analysis. By automating time-consuming tasks, marketers can focus more on strategy and creative endeavors, optimizing their overall marketing efforts.

6. Image and Video Recognition

AI-powered image and video recognition tools allow marketers to analyze and categorize visual content more efficiently. With these tools, marketers can extract valuable insights from images and videos, such as identifying brand logos, product placements, or analyzing customer reactions and sentiments towards visual content.

7. Customer Segmentation

AI-based customer segmentation tools cluster individuals into target groups based on shared characteristics or behaviors. By segmenting their customer base, marketers can tailor their marketing campaigns to specific groups, delivering personalized messages and offers that resonate with each segment, leading to higher conversion rates and customer loyalty.

8. Social Listening Tools

Social listening tools utilize AI algorithms to monitor and analyze social media platforms, detecting mentions, trends, and customer sentiments related to a brand or product. These tools provide valuable insights into customer opinions, preferences, and industry trends, helping marketers enhance brand reputation, identify potential influencers, and adapt marketing strategies accordingly.

9. Content Generation

AI-powered content generation tools employ natural language generation to automatically create written or visual content based on input data. These tools can generate blog posts, social media captions, product descriptions, and even videos. They help marketers streamline content creation processes, save time, and maintain consistency in their messaging.

10. Recommendation Engines

Recommendation engines leverage AI algorithms to suggest products, services, or content to users based on their preferences and previous interactions. By analyzing user behavior and historical data, these tools personalize the user experience and drive cross-selling or upselling opportunities, improving customer satisfaction and increasing revenue.

What are AI tools used in marketing?

AI tools used in marketing refer to various applications and technologies that leverage artificial intelligence to enhance marketing processes. These tools use machine learning, natural language processing, and other AI techniques to analyze data, automate tasks, and provide valuable insights that help businesses make informed marketing decisions.

How do AI tools benefit marketing?

AI tools offer several benefits to marketing, including improved customer segmentation, personalized targeting, predictive analytics, automated campaign management, and enhanced customer experiences. They can analyze vast amounts of data quickly, identify patterns, and provide actionable insights that enable marketers to optimize their strategies and achieve better results.

What are some popular AI tools used in marketing?

Some popular AI tools used in marketing include chatbots, sentiment analysis tools, recommendation engines, predictive lead scoring platforms, automated email marketing tools, and AI-powered content creation platforms. There are also AI-based CRM systems, social media listening tools, and AI-driven data analytics platforms that help marketers gather insights and make data-driven decisions.

How do AI tools improve customer segmentation?

AI tools can analyze large volumes of customer data, including demographics, behavior, purchasing history, and social media activity, to identify meaningful segments. By understanding customer preferences and behavior patterns, marketers can create targeted campaigns and personalized experiences that resonate with specific customer segments, leading to better engagement and conversions.

Can AI tools automate marketing tasks?

Yes, AI tools can automate various marketing tasks such as email marketing, social media posting, ad campaign optimization, lead nurturing, and content creation. By automating routine tasks, marketers can save time, improve efficiency, and focus on strategic activities that require human creativity and decision-making.

How do AI tools assist in predictive analytics?

AI tools use historical data and machine learning algorithms to forecast future trends, behavior patterns, and outcomes. By analyzing past performance, customer preferences, market trends, and other variables, AI can generate predictive models that help marketers make data-driven decisions, optimize marketing strategies, and improve campaign effectiveness.

Are AI tools capable of personalizing marketing efforts?

Absolutely! AI tools can analyze customer data, preferences, browsing behavior, and purchase history to create personalized marketing experiences. They can dynamically adjust content, offers, and recommendations based on individual customer profiles, increasing relevance and engagement. Personalization helps marketers build stronger relationships with customers and drive higher conversions.

Can AI tools improve customer experiences?

Yes, AI tools play a significant role in enhancing customer experiences. They can provide real-time customer support through chatbots, offer personalized recommendations, and streamline purchasing processes. AI-powered virtual assistants can engage with customers, answer queries, and provide assistance, even when human resources are limited, ensuring round-the-clock availability and remarkable customer experiences.

Do AI tools help in analyzing customer sentiment?

Yes, AI tools equipped with natural language processing capabilities can analyze customer sentiment by evaluating social media conversations, online reviews, customer feedback, and other sources of text data. By understanding customer emotions, businesses can identify areas of improvement, monitor brand reputation, and take proactive measures to address customer concerns and preferences.

What skills are required to utilize AI tools in marketing effectively?

To utilize AI tools effectively, marketers should possess skills in data analysis, statistics, and machine learning concepts. Understanding how AI algorithms work and having knowledge of marketing principles and strategies will enable marketers to interpret AI-generated insights, apply them to marketing campaigns, and continuously optimize their strategies based on AI-driven recommendations.
